Students are exactly the people museums exist to reach, and exactly the people who can least afford a string of separate entry fees on a tight budget. So the student pass carries the lowest per-person rate we offer. It is the same pass technically — a QR code on your phone, the same coverage options, the same instant delivery and offline use — priced down for anyone with valid current enrolment at a school, college or university, in Egypt or abroad. This page explains how the rate works, how proof is handled, and how to combine it with a group booking.
To get the student rate, you show valid proof of current enrolment — a student card with a current date, an enrolment letter, or an equivalent document — at the point of purchase. We check it once to confirm eligibility and we do not retain it afterwards; the privacy page spells that out. The proof can be for any recognised educational institution, Egyptian or international, because a visiting student deserves the same rate as a local one. There is no separate "student verification service" to sign up for and no ongoing membership — you prove enrolment when you buy, and that is the end of it.
At the museum door, the QR pass is scanned exactly as any other pass; the student rate is settled entirely at purchase, so there is no awkward "show your student card again" moment at the entry. That said, carrying your student card while travelling is always sensible, since individual museums may run their own separate student concessions on top of what the pass covers.

There is no age limit — what matters is current enrolment, not age. A mature student returning to study, a postgraduate researcher, or an undergraduate all qualify equally, as long as the enrolment is current and you can show valid proof at purchase. We deliberately tie the rate to being a student rather than to a birth year, because that is who the concession is really for.
